FOIA Requests in 120-Day Limbo — Or Are They? [7]

In January 2009, President Obama reversed Bush administration policy and ordered most federal agencies to err on the side of disclosure when responding to FOIA requests. Why, then, are a number of agencies still operating under the old policies?

Obscure Farm Bill Provision Blacks Out Agricultural Data [8]

The USDA is interpreting a provision in the 2008 Farm Bill so broadly that it may amount to a FOIA exemption for most information about individual agricultural operations.
